Abstract:
The current research is conducted to evaluate early maladaptive schemas. It aimed to study the earlymaladaptive schemas of depressed, anxious or obsessive compulsive patients along with early maladaptiveschemas of individuals in non-clinical group. The statistical population was selected randomly from thepatients that were suffering from depression, anxiety and obsessive compulsive disorder who visited ShafaPsychiatric Hospital in Rasht in 2014 to 2015. In order to collect data, Young Schema and DASS-21questionnaire plus Maudsley Obsessive Compulsive Inventory were used. Data were analyzed usingmultivariate analysis of variance. The results showed that there is a difference between early maladaptiveschemas of patients with depression, anxiety and OCD in vulnerability to harm or illness, unrelentingstandards/ hypercriticalness, undeveloped self / enmeshment, failures, dependency/ incompetence,entitlement /grandiosity and emotional inhibition and early maladaptive schemas of non-clinical group
